Ricketts Earns Second WAC Pitcher of the Week Honor This Season

DENVER –Hawai`i's Stephanie Ricketts was named the Verizon Wireless Western Athletic Conference Pitcher of the Week for March 22-28. This is her second honor of the season and fourth of Ricketts' career.
  
Ricketts, a sophomore from San Jose, Calif., went 2-0 with a 0.41 ERA in two complete games against San Jose State last week. She pitched 17.0 innings, allowing just three runs, one earned with eight strike outs. In the WAC opener, she threw a season-high 10 innings, giving up two runs (one earned) in UH's longest game of the season. Ricketts was one out away from a complete game shutout in the series finale, but an error in the seventh led to SJSU's only run of the game. She was able to hold the hot-hitting Spartans to a .175 average through the two games.
 
Overall, Ricketts is 11-6 with 14 complete games and an ERA of 2.36 in 121.2 innings.
 
This marks the fifth time a Rainbow Wahine has earned the WAC's weekly award this season. Ricketts' has earned the award twice (Week 4 and Week 7); freshman centerfielder, Kelly Majam, was named the WAC's Hitter of the Week twice (Week 2 and Week 6); and freshman pitcher, Kaia Parnaby, was selected in Week 2.
 
Hawai'i travels to the mainland this week for a pivotal roadtrip in which they will play three, three-game series in three different states in eight days. The 'Bows begin the trip at New Mexico State (Apr. 3-4) before heading to Utah State for a mid-week match-up (Apr. 6-7). UH then finishes their second roadtrip of the year at Boise State.
